When Performance Degrades Post-Reinstallation?
Sometimes, a module appears to work initially but soon begins to act up. This could include problems such as engine misfires, erratic shifting, or warning lights reappearing. These symptoms do not necessarily indicate a faulty refurbished unit. They could suggest issues like outdated calibration files, unstable voltage, or ground loop errors. Since many modules adapt to vehicle-specific parameters, reconnection can unmask underlying problems. For example, battery drain or poor sensor feedback might cause the module to underperform. Reinstallation problems often arise from incorrect wiring or missed diagnostic steps. In such cases, we guide our customers in verifying the surrounding systems. First Steps You Should Take
Resetting the vehicle's system is often the first step toward resolution. A hard battery reset involves disconnecting the negative terminal for about 10 to 15 minutes. This process clears temporary memory and may resolve minor integration conflicts. Once power is restored, many modules reinitialize and recalibrate. It's crucial to monitor how the vehicle behaves after this reset. If symptoms persist, it may indicate a deeper issue beyond software glitches. Make sure to reconnect all components securely and avoid disturbing any wire harnesses. This simple yet effective step has resolved many of our customer complaints. Remember, always record the vehicle’s behavior before and after the reset.
Run a Full Vehicle Diagnostic Scan
A full scan helps identify specific trouble codes that can guide further troubleshooting. Use a reliable OBD-II scanner to extract both active and pending fault codes. Make sure to document each code, along with observed symptoms like flickering lights or delayed response. Understanding which modules are affected helps isolate whether the issue originates from the refurbished unit or another system. We recommend running the scan before contacting UpFix, as it provides a technical snapshot. These scans are often crucial for identifying low voltage, faulty sensors, or bad grounds. If you encounter errors you don't recognize, our support team is ready to interpret the data. Timely scans allow us to help you much faster and avoid unnecessary returns.
Checklist: How to Troubleshoot a Refurbished Unit Properly
Troubleshooting your refurbished module requires a structured approach. Below is a step-by-step list that our technicians recommend to narrow down the root cause.
- Disconnect the battery for at least 10 minutes to reset system memory.
- Run a full OBD-II scan and record all DTCs (Diagnostic Trouble Codes).
- Compare new symptoms with those experienced before the repair.
- Inspect all related wiring harnesses, ground points, and voltage supply at connectors.
- Contact UpFix with detailed error codes, photos of dashboard lights, and wiring conditions.
These steps will prepare both you and our technicians to determine the true cause of the issue and resolve it efficiently.

Common Vehicle-Side Causes We Encounter
A functioning unit can still behave abnormally if other vehicle systems are malfunctioning. Some of the most frequent issues we encounter include poor ground connections, corroded wiring, or failing sensors. In many cases, customers reinstall a module without first checking vehicle voltage or firmware version. These oversights often lead to complaints after installation. Common issues such as low battery charge, outdated vehicle software, or dirty sensor inputs affect module behavior. We've also seen failures due to improper reinstallation or interference with the CAN-bus network. Customers frequently ask about how to remove ABS modules, and doing so incorrectly may damage connectors or wiring. Whenever you reinstall a unit, take time to double-check every cable, pin, and fuse. Case Study – A Transmission Control Module Misdiagnosis
A customer returned a Transmission Control Module (TCM) and claimed that the vehicle was shifting more erratically than before. This was a troubling report because the unit had passed our final tests. The driver mentioned sudden jerks during gear changes and hesitation during acceleration. The dashboard displayed no codes at the time of return. Frustrated, the customer assumed the TCM was faulty and requested an exchange. We asked the customer to document the wiring setup and provide battery voltage levels. After following our request, they submitted detailed reports for analysis. Our team began an extensive review to rule out a unit-side issue.
UpFix Diagnostic Outcome
Upon testing, the returned unit functioned perfectly under all bench test scenarios. We reviewed the error logs and installation steps provided by the customer. It turned out the vehicle had worn-out ground straps and partially frayed harness insulation. Battery load testing also showed a weak charge during engine start. These external conditions directly influenced TCM performance and led to incorrect shifts. Our certified technician explained how voltage dips could confuse shift logic. Once the customer resolved the wiring and battery issues, the symptoms disappeared. This case shows why in-depth diagnostics are essential.
Final Resolution
The customer replaced the damaged harness and installed a new, fully charged battery. They then reinstalled the original UpFix-refurbished module and cleared all fault codes. The vehicle resumed normal shifting patterns, confirming that the unit was never the issue. This case serves as a reminder to always consider the bigger diagnostic picture. What if my refurbished module isn’t working as expected?
Begin with a battery reset and a full OBD-II diagnostic scan. Record all error codes and vehicle behavior, then contact UpFix with the information. Our team will help you determine if the issue lies with the module or elsewhere in the vehicle.
Could the issue be with my vehicle and not the unit?
Yes, often the problem is vehicle-related, such as faulty wiring, outdated software, or bad sensors. These external factors can cause modules to behave unpredictably even if they are functioning correctly.
